IT all adds up for students at Hipperholme Grammar School.
Jayvian Mavi and Nichola Backhouse achieved gold in the summer term 2014 Junior Maths Challenge part of national event involving a quarter of a million pupils across the country and run by the United Kingdom Mathematics Trust from the School of Mathematics at the University of Leeds.
To achieve gold, students are ranked in approximately the top two per cent of the UK's mathematical population.
Jayvian also achieved Best in School and Best in Year Eight and Nichola was Best in Year Seven. Harrison Layden-Fritz and Ben Cooper achieved bronze, along with Zainab Sajjad, Sophie Noble and Isabelle Williams.
